The Olympus CX31 is a fixed specification binocular microscope for teaching and routine applications. It offers a rigid and durable construction with high performance and long life time. The optics provide bright and even images and adapters allow mounting of Olympus digital cameras for easy and efficient digital imaging.
The Olympus plan corrected UIS2 objectives ensure bright, clear images with excellent flatness.
Optimised contrast
The integrated Abbe-condenser with its optimised aperture stops increases the visibility and contrast of the specimen under different magnifications without time-consuming adjustments.
Ergonomic design
All main controls (focusing knob, light control adjustment and stage handle) of the microscope are located close together so that the user can operate the microscope with minimal movements.
FluoLED - LED Fluorescence Illuminator
FluoLED fluorescence illuminators are designed to fit to the Olympus CX microscopes making them ideal for routine as well as educational purposes. The LEDs can be powered by battery or even solar power ensuring that fluorescence microscopy can be conducted ‘in field’ where samples are fresh. The FluoLED system is available in three versions, to provide transmitted fluorescence, without removing the ability to perform normal brightfield illumination: The FluoLED EasyBlue (480 nm) provides a single wavelength of fixed intensity for the most cost efficient solution. The FluoLED Single provides users with the capability to use one of seven interchangeable LED cassettes from 365 nm (UV) to 630 nm (Red) and control the intensity of the light. The FluoLED MultiFluo enables up to three of the interchangeable LED cassettes to be installed and controlled on the microscope at once via a three channel electronic driver.
Easy and safe transport
The compact design as well as the 'student proof' component security and durability allow the mobile use of the CX21. The attachment of an optional mirror unit allows observations to be made even in the field when no power source is available. A wooden storage box with handle for easy carrying is available as an optional accessory.
Specification CX31
Optical system | UIS2 (Universal Infinity-corrected) optical system | |
---|---|---|
Illumination | Built-in transmitted Koehler illuminator | |
6V30W halogen bulb | ||
100-120V/220-240Vg 0.85/0.45A 50/60Hz | ||
Focusing mechanism | Stage height movement by roller guide (rack & pinion) | |
Coarse adjustment stroke | 36.8 mm per turn | |
Total stroke | 25 mm | |
Pre-focusing knob provided, coarse adjustment knob tension adjustable | ||
Revolving nosepiece | Quadruple positions fixed (Inward tilted) | |
Binocular observation tube | Field number | 20 |
Tube tilting angle | 30° | |
Interpupillary distance adjustment range | 48 to 75 mm | |
Stage | 188 (W) x 134 (D) mm | |
Movement range | 76 (X-axis) x 50 (Y-axis) mm | |
Double specimen silde holder | ||
Condenser | Type | Abbe condenser, with built-in daylight filter |
N.A. | 1.25 (when immersed with oil) | |
Aperture iris diaphragm | Built in | |
Dimensions & weight | 233(W) x 511(H) x 367.5(D) mm, approx. 8 kg | |
Operating environment | Indoor use | |
Altitude | Max. 2000 meters | |
Ambient temperature | 5° to 40°C (41° to 104° F) | |
Maximum relative humidity | 80% for temperatures up to 31°C | |
Supply voltage fluctuations; Not to exceed ±10% of the normal voltage | ||
Pollution degree | 2 (in accordance with IEC60664) | |
Installation/Overvoltage category | II (in accordance with IEC60664) |
